Cakes and Desserts

Always use microwave-safe ceramic, glass or plastic utensils.

Before adding measured amount of batter, grease bottoms and sides of dishes, but do not flour. Or, for
easy removal, line dish with wax paper or paper towel.

Cakes are done when toothpick or long skewer stuck in center comes out clean.

Crust on cakes will be soft. Refrigerate cake if firm exterior is desired for frosting.
